Burwash is a compact village and civil parish in the district of Rother, set in the rolling, wooded landscape of the High Weald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ty in East Sussex, England. Its centre is characterised by sandstone and flint buildings, narrow lanes and traditional village amenities, with farming and small local businesses still shaping the economy and a lively community life centred on the village hall, pubs and clubs.

Burwash is best known for its literary connection: the 17th‑century house Bateman's, home of Rudyard Kipling for three decades, is now cared for by the National Trust and draws walkers and history enthusiasts. The surrounding countryside offers footpaths, ancient woodland and an essentially rural character that supports modest tourism alongside everyday village life.
